Barbara Jean Koehler, 85 of Stephenson, VA, formerly of Bedford and Hanover, PA, passed away peacefully at her home on Friday, August 14, 2026, after a brief struggle with cancer.
She was born October 1, 1940, in Hanover, PA, the daughter of the late Louis Francis Patrick Noel and Mary Shaffer Noel.
Barbara was a graduate of Eichelberger High School class of 1958. She retired in 2005 after 33 years of service as an account clerk, processing parking tickets for the Winchester Police Department. While her daughters were young Barb served as a crossing guard for Quarles Elementary School and John Kerr Middle School, where a lot of the students began to call her mom. She also worked briefly at Capital records as a master checker.
Barb enjoyed traveling to Hawaii, Europe, Myrtle Beach, Williamsburg, and many parts of the United States with her husband, family, and friends. Some of her favorite activities included riding her own motorcycle, dancing, listening to music, reading, doing puzzles, attending flea markets, and enjoying her favorite beverages from Starbucks. She also enjoyed annual Labor Day family weekends for many years at her father’s deer camp. Barb was also involved with the Winchester Apple Blossom Festival.
